Activities:

·        Attended Brevard County Summit primarily dealing with the impact of property tax reform measures on local government jurisdictions.

 

·        Attended meeting with representatives from Brevard County Fire Rescue and various municipalities to discuss a draft report prepared for the County Commission to present the benefits of the 1st Responder Program.

 

·        Participated in the selection and interview process for the new Town Clerk.

 

·        Attended monthly membership meeting of the Space Coast League of Cities with presentation on Communities for a Lifetime Program.

 

·        Attended Parks Board meeting to evaluate the 2008 Founders Day event.

 

·        Attended Board of Adjustment meeting. Approval was granted to operate an eating and drinking establishment for Sand on the Beach (former Boomerang’s). This approval included a number of conditions related to its operation and design. The Final Order outling the associated conditions will be prepared for consideration by the Board of Adjustment at its regular meeting on June 19th. The Board also granted the requested variance to allow the utilization of five (5) off-street parking spaces which will require the First Avenue beach access for maneuvering. These spaces are all contained on the property owned by Sand on the Beach.

 

·        Met with representatives of the History Center Board to discuss the use of revenue derived from rentals.

 

·        Public Works staff began repainting stop bars and crosswalks throughout Town.

 

·        Public Works staff initiated placement of wheel stops at Ocean Avenue parking spaces in front of Ryckman Park in lieu of wooden posts.
